Retail and F & B Marketing Manager


A key member of the marketing team, responsible for planning, managing and executing marketing campaigns related to retail projects, ensuring all communication is on-brand, consistent and fit for purpose.


  • Work with the Head of Marketing Campaigns and CRM, as well as the Retail Director, to drive retail sales targets at all Parkdean Resorts holiday parks, as well as enhance customer engagement and experience, driving on park spend.
  • Collaborate with colleagues to gather requirements, effectively translating these into marketing projects and communication plans.
  • Map out the tasks, timescales and budget needed to develop and execute campaigns and on park material, effectively communicating the associated requirements with internal colleagues.
  • Effectively manage and mentor one Marketing Services Executives.
  • Brief, manage and liaise with external design and production agencies to ensure marketing materials and campaigns are produced and executed successfully, within timescales and budget.
  • Identify process workflows to improve collaboration between teams.
  • Support the development of the company brand. Act as brand guardian ensuring appropriate use – including all material that is customer facing – promotional and non-promotional across entertainment and retail.
  • Successfully design campaigns to increase on park spent on food & beverage, activities and entertainment
  • Take ownership of the quality of internal and external marketing material
  • KPI driven and analytical thinker who can successfully impact on park spend through promotional activity


Key Skills and Experience Required


  • Appropriate degree or professional qualification and a proven experience in retail marketing
  • Exceptional project management skills and experience, with strong attention to detail
  • Experience of working with or for design agencies, print and production suppliers
  • Strong influential skills
  • Strong planning and organisation skills
  • Commercial minded
  • Excellent decision-making skills
  • Good relationship building and collaboration skills
  • Previous managerial experience
